Organic Baby Jackets Will Keep Your Babies Nice and Warm

December 2nd, 2009

During the summer, your babies don’t need much more than a little onesie, and sometimes parents just dress them in long shirts.  However, during the winter you want to keep your babies as warm as possible.  To that end, you need to have a little jacket for your baby.  If, however, you want to avoid dressing your baby in anything that contains artificial fibers or chemical dyes, there are many jackets and coats that you’ll want to avoid.  However, there are a number of organic baby jackets out there.

Corduroy hooded jackets are great choices for keeping your baby warm during the cold winters.  These corduroy jackets are made out of top quality fabric that features no artificial fibers.  Corduroy is very warm, and once the jacket is buttoned up, your baby will be snug and protected from chilly drafts.  These jackets can be found in several different sizes and colors.

Organic cotton jackets are also an option for natural yet warm baby outerwear.  Made from cotton, they’re incredibly soft.  They’re lined with a plush cotton lining that will keep your babies comfortable and warm.  Since cotton is so breathable, you’ll be able to use this jacket during the fall and the spring, too, until the weather starts to warm up.  None of the snaps used on these organic cotton jackets contain any nickel, and there hood comes without a drawstring so there’s no choking hazard.  These jackets are available in 1T and 2T sizes and in several different colors.

In addition to these two types of organic baby jackets, there are a number of other accessories you can get.  They include organic hats and booties to help keep your baby warm during the winter, plus they look incredibly stylish.
